当前位置:首页 > 软件开发 > 正文内容

定州探索3D软件定制开发:技术革新与个性化服务的融合

sddzlsc3周前 (02-18)软件开发290

定州

1.1 3D软件定制开发的定义与重要性

在我眼中,3D软件定制开发不仅仅是一个技术术语,它代表了一种创新和个性化的服务。想象一下,我们能够根据特定的需求,打造出独一无二的3D软件,这就像是为每个项目量身定做一套衣服。这种定制化的开发方式,能够确保软件的功能和性能完全符合用户的需求,从而提高工作效率和项目成功率。在数字化时代,这种定制化服务的重要性不言而喻,它能够帮助企业在激烈的市场竞争中脱颖而出。

定州

1.2 3D软件定制开发的应用领域

谈到3D软件定制开发的应用领域,那真是包罗万象。从建筑和工程领域,到游戏和娱乐产业,再到教育和医疗行业,3D软件定制开发都能发挥其独特的价值。比如在建筑领域,定制的3D软件可以帮助设计师更直观地展示建筑模型,优化设计流程;在游戏产业,定制的3D引擎可以提供更逼真的视觉效果和更流畅的游戏体验。这些应用不仅提高了行业的工作效率,也为用户带来了更加丰富和个性化的体验。

定州

1.3 定制开发的优势与挑战

定州定制开发的优势显而易见。首先,它能够提供高度个性化的解决方案,满足特定用户的独特需求。其次,定制软件往往更加灵活,能够随着业务的发展和技术的进步而不断进化。然而,定制开发也面临着挑战,比如成本和时间的投入通常比标准化软件要高,而且需要专业的技术团队来支持。此外,定制软件的维护和升级也需要更多的资源和专业知识。尽管如此,对于追求卓越和创新的企业来说,这些挑战往往是值得克服的。

2.1 需求分析与规划

定州

2.1.1 确定业务需求

定州在开始3D软件定制开发的旅程时,首要任务是深入了解客户的业务需求。这就像是在建造房子之前,先要画出蓝图。我会与客户进行深入的沟通,了解他们的业务流程、目标以及面临的挑战。通过这种方式,我们可以确保定制的3D软件能够解决实际问题,提高工作效率。这个过程需要耐心和细致,因为每一个细节都可能影响到最终软件的性能和用户体验。

2.1.2 技术可行性评估

在明确了业务需求之后,接下来就是评估技术可行性。我会从技术的角度出发,分析实现这些需求的可能性和限制。这包括考虑现有的技术资源、开发周期以及预算等因素。通过这样的评估,我们可以确定哪些功能是可行的,哪些需要进行调整或者寻找替代方案。这一步是确保项目成功的关键,因为它涉及到如何在现实的限制下,最大限度地满足客户的需求。

定州

2.2 设计与架构

2.2.1 用户界面设计

用户界面设计是3D软件定制开发中的重要环节。我会根据用户的需求和使用习惯,设计直观、易用的用户界面。这不仅仅是为了让软件看起来美观,更重要的是提高用户的工作效率和体验。我会使用专业的设计工具,创建原型和交互模型,确保用户界面既符合功能需求,又具有良好的用户体验。

2.2.2 系统架构规划

定州在用户界面设计的同时,我会开始规划系统的架构。这包括确定软件的模块化设计、数据流和接口规范等。一个好的系统架构能够确保软件的稳定性和可扩展性,同时也便于未来的维护和升级。我会考虑到软件的性能要求、安全性以及与其他系统的集成需求,确保架构设计能够满足这些关键因素。

2.3 开发与测试

2.3.1 选择开发工具与技术栈

定州进入开发阶段,首先要选择适合项目的开发工具和技术栈。我会根据项目的需求和团队的技术背景,选择最合适的技术方案。这可能包括3D建模软件、编程语言、数据库管理系统等。选择正确的工具和技术栈,可以大大提高开发效率,降低项目风险。

定州

2.3.2 编码与实现

接下来就是编码和实现阶段。我会组织团队成员,根据设计文档和架构规划,进行代码编写。在这个过程中,我会强调代码的质量和可维护性,确保软件的稳定性和可靠性。同时,我也会关注团队的协作和沟通,确保项目的顺利进行。

2.3.3 测试与质量保证

在编码的同时,我会开展软件的测试工作。这包括单元测试、集成测试和系统测试等,以确保软件的每个部分都能正常工作,满足功能需求。我会使用自动化测试工具,提高测试的效率和准确性。通过严格的测试和质量保证,我们可以及时发现并修复软件中的问题,确保最终交付的软件质量。

2.4 部署与维护

2.4.1 部署策略

定州当软件开发完成并通过测试后,接下来就是部署阶段。我会与客户讨论部署策略,包括部署的时间、地点和方式等。这需要考虑到客户的业务连续性和数据安全等因素。我会制定详细的部署计划,确保软件能够平稳、安全地部署到生产环境中。

定州

2.4.2 持续维护与更新

最后,软件的部署并不是项目的终点。我会为客户提供持续的维护和更新服务。这包括监控软件的运行状态,及时修复发现的问题,以及根据客户的反馈和市场的变化,进行功能的升级和优化。通过持续的维护和更新,我们可以确保软件始终保持最佳状态,满足客户不断变化的需求。

扫描二维码推送至手机访问。

版权声明:本文由顺沃网络-小程序开发-网站建设-app开发发布,如需转载请注明出处。

本文链接:https://dingzhou.shunwoit.com/post/124.html

分享给朋友:

“定州探索3D软件定制开发:技术革新与个性化服务的融合” 的相关文章

定州提升企业竞争力:定制化APP软件开发的关键优势

在当今这个数字化时代,企业级移动应用开发已经成为企业运营不可或缺的一部分。我深刻地意识到,一个精心设计的移动应用能够极大地提升企业的运营效率。想象一下,员工们通过一个定制化的应用程序,可以随时随地访问企业资源,进行沟通协作,这无疑会加快工作流程,减少时间浪费。 1.1 企业运营效率的提升 对我来说,...

定州提升效率与竞争力:定制开发直销软件的全面指南

在当今竞争激烈的商业环境中,直销软件成为了企业拓展市场、提高效率的重要工具。我深刻体会到,拥有一款能够满足特定业务需求的直销软件,对于企业来说至关重要。这不仅仅是一个简单的软件,它关系到企业能否在市场中快速响应,以及是否能够高效地管理销售流程。 直销软件的重要性 直销软件对于企业来说,就像是指挥官手...

定州选择WMS软件开发公司:专业能力、行业经验与服务对比

1.1 什么是WMS系统 WMS系统,即仓库管理系统,是一种专为仓库管理设计的软件解决方案。它帮助企业优化库存管理,提高仓库操作的效率和准确性。对我来说,WMS系统就像是仓库的大脑,它能够追踪库存的每一个细节,从入库到出库,再到库存盘点,每一个环节都井井有条。这种系统能够确保库存数据的实时更新,减少...

定州掌握MATLAB上位机软件开发:从基础到高级通信协议

1.1 MATLAB上位机软件定义 当我开始接触MATLAB上位机软件开发时,我意识到这不仅仅是编写代码那么简单。上位机软件,简单来说,就是运行在计算机上的软件,它负责与下位机(通常是嵌入式系统或微控制器)进行通信,实现数据的收集、处理和显示。在工业自动化领域,上位机软件扮演着大脑的角色,指挥着整个...

定州全面解析:区块链App软件定制开发的关键技术与流程

区块链技术,这个曾经只在极客圈里流传的术语,如今已经走进了大众的视野。它不仅仅是一种技术,更是一种全新的思维方式。在1.1节中,我们将深入探讨区块链技术的定义和核心特性,以及它的发展历史。 1.1 区块链技术简介 区块链,这个词汇听起来就像是一连串的区块连接在一起。实际上,它是一种分布式数据库技术,...

定州掌握C#开发:构建高效大型软件的秘诀

1.1 什么是C#开发的大型软件 当我谈论C#开发的大型软件时,我指的是那些复杂、功能丰富的应用程序,它们通常需要处理大量的数据和用户交互。这些软件系统往往涉及到企业级的解决方案,比如客户关系管理(CRM)系统、企业资源规划(ERP)系统,或者是复杂的游戏和模拟环境。C#作为一种强大的编程语言,提供...

发表评论

访客

看不清,换一张

◎欢迎参与讨论,请在这里发表您的看法和观点。